If I can, just a few words of warning; those prefab/kit coops are normally over rated when advertising the number of chickens they can accommodate and in general, it is usually about half what they say :(

Also, chicken wire is great at keeping chickens in but pretty much useless at keeping predators out so some reinforcement may need to be added, depending on what the coop is constructed with.
